AAJA convention scholarship deadline EXTENDED to June 12

We’ve extended the deadline to NOON June 12 for the AAJA Seattle Founder’s Scholarship. AAJA Seattle can help one student pay for registration to the 2009 AAJA National Convention in Boston. Take a break from your summer internship to talk to hiring editors and recruiters at newspapers across the country. It’s a chance to make connections for future internships and jobs. The AAJA convention is also a chance to meet other journalists throughout the country and get inspired in your work and career.

Please apply for the AAJA Seattle Founder’s Scholarship by noon June 12, which is a Friday. To apply, please submit a 500-word statement on what you hope to learn at the conference. Send the statement to AAJA Seattle at aajaseattle@gmail.com with the phrase “Founder’s Scholarship” in the subject line.

The recipient will be responsible for airfare, lodging and any other incidentals. He or she may be able to split a room with another journalist attending the conference. The chapter has members going to the convention who may still be looking for a roommate. This year’s convention is Aug. 12-15.
